So often you get from experiment NOT what you expected - and you ask: what the hell is going on there? You want to find WHY, run more accurate experiment and deviate more and more from original goal into newly found phenomenon. And it always like this in science - discoveries are where you do not expect them.

So, main driver in science is personal curiosity and desire to find out what is wrong - why prediction and observation do not match.
